Skip to contents

All functions

Opal()
Create a Opal driver
dsAggregate(<OpalConnection>)
Aggregate data
dsAssignExpr(<OpalConnection>)
Assign the result of an expression
dsAssignResource(<OpalConnection>)
Assign a resource
dsAssignTable(<OpalConnection>)
Assign a table
dsConnect(<OpalDriver>)
Connect to a Opal server
dsDisconnect(<OpalConnection>)
Disconnect from a Opal server
dsFetch(<OpalResult>)
Fetch the result
dsGetInfo(<OpalResult>)
Get result info
dsHasResource(<OpalConnection>)
Verify Opal resource
dsHasSession(<OpalConnection>)
Check remote R session exists
dsHasTable(<OpalConnection>)
Verify Opal table
dsIsAsync(<OpalConnection>)
Opal asynchronous support
dsIsCompleted(<OpalResult>)
Get whether the operation is completed
dsIsReady(<OpalSession>)
Get whether the remote R session is up and running
dsKeepAlive(<OpalConnection>)
Keep connection with a Opal server alive
dsListMethods(<OpalConnection>)
List methods
dsListPackages(<OpalConnection>)
List packages
dsListProfiles(<OpalConnection>)
List profiles
dsListResources(<OpalConnection>)
List Opal resources
dsListSymbols(<OpalConnection>)
List R symbols
dsListTables(<OpalConnection>)
List Opal tables
dsListWorkspaces(<OpalConnection>)
List workspaces
dsRestoreWorkspace(<OpalConnection>)
Restore workspace
dsRmSymbol(<OpalConnection>)
Remove a R symbol
dsRmWorkspace(<OpalConnection>)
Remove a workspace
dsSaveWorkspace(<OpalConnection>)
Save workspace
dsSession(<OpalConnection>)
Create a remote R session
dsStateMessage(<OpalSession>)
Get the remote R session state message
logindata.opal.demo
DataSHIELD login data file